The Mortgage Formula Explained
The core of the excel sheet mortgage calculator is the standard mortgage payment formula, which calculates the fixed monthly payment (M). The formula is:
M = P [ i(1 + i)^n ] / [ (1 + i)^n – 1 ]
This formula ensures that each payment covers the interest accrued for that month, with the remainder reducing the loan’s principal balance.
| Variable | Meaning | Unit / Example | Typical Range |
|---|---|---|---|
| M | Total Monthly Mortgage Payment | Currency ($) | Calculated Result |
| P | Principal Loan Amount | Currency ($) | $50,000 – $2,000,000+ |
| i | Monthly Interest Rate | Percentage (%) | Annual Rate / 12 |
| n | Total Number of Payments | Months | Loan Term (Years) * 12 |
Practical Examples
Example 1: Standard 30-Year Mortgage
Imagine a family is buying a home with the following details:
- Inputs:
- Loan Amount (P): $350,000
- Annual Interest Rate: 6.0%
- Loan Term: 30 Years
- Results:
- Monthly Payment (M): $2,098.43
- Total Interest Paid: $405,435.60
- Total Cost of Loan: $755,435.60
This example shows that over 30 years, the total interest paid is more than the original loan amount itself, a key insight provided by a detailed calculator.
Example 2: The Impact of a Shorter Term
Now consider the same loan, but with a 15-year term:
- Inputs:
- Loan Amount (P): $350,000
- Annual Interest Rate: 6.0%
- Loan Term: 15 Years
- Results:
- Monthly Payment (M): $2,953.53
- Total Interest Paid: $181,635.09
- Total Cost of Loan: $531,635.09

Key Factors That Affect Your Mortgage
Several key factors influence your monthly payment and the total cost of your mortgage. Understanding them is critical for securing the best possible terms.
- Credit Score: A higher credit score generally leads to a lower interest rate, as lenders see you as a lower-risk borrower. This is often the most significant factor.
- Down Payment: A larger down payment reduces your loan amount (the principal) and can help you avoid Private Mortgage Insurance (PMI), lowering your monthly costs.
- Loan Term: Shorter loan terms (e.g., 15 years) have higher monthly payments but accumulate far less interest over the life of the loan compared to longer terms (e.g., 30 years).
- Interest Rate Type: A fixed-rate mortgage has a constant interest rate, while an adjustable-rate mortgage (ARM) has a rate that can change over time, affecting your payment.
- Economic Conditions: Broader economic factors like inflation and Federal Reserve policies can influence overall mortgage rate trends in the market.

Frequently Asked Questions (FAQ)
1. What does amortization mean?
Amortization is the process of paying off a debt over time in regular installments. In a mortgage, each payment is split between principal and interest. The amortization schedule shows this breakdown for every payment.
2. Why is more of my payment going to interest at the beginning?
Interest is calculated based on the outstanding loan balance. In the early years, the balance is highest, so the interest portion of your payment is also at its peak. As you pay down the principal, the interest portion decreases.
3. Can I make extra payments with this calculator?

4. Does this calculator include taxes and insurance (PITI)?
No, this is a principal and interest (P&I) calculator. Your total monthly housing payment (PITI) will also include property taxes, homeowners insurance, and possibly PMI, which can add a significant amount.

6. How much does a larger down payment save me?
A larger down payment saves you money in two ways: it reduces the principal loan amount, which lowers your monthly payment and total interest, and it can help you secure a lower interest rate from the lender.
7. What’s the difference between a 15-year and 30-year mortgage?
A 15-year mortgage has higher monthly payments but a lower interest rate and total interest cost. A 30-year mortgage has lower, more manageable monthly payments but costs significantly more in interest over the loan’s life.
